I am preparing an undergraduate course covering descriptive statistics,
exploratory data analysis, and an introduction to microcomputers.  I
have done this before using exercises based on my own data, but I'd
like to see what else is available for demonstrating exploratory methods
of analysis.

Especially helpful would be exercises with data sets that appear to be
unpatterned, but which reveal interesting patterns after the student
controls for this and transforms that.

Any suggestions would be appreciated.  Thanks in advance --
